Steps to Obtain a French Driving License

For those wishing to acquire a French driving license, here are the important actions to follow:

  1. Eligibility Check

    • Guarantee you are at least 18 years of ages for a Category B license.
    • Hold a legitimate recognition document and evidence of home in France.
  2. Register in Driving School

    • Pick a certified driving school (auto-école). This is mandatory unless you wish to transform a foreign license.
    • Costs can vary significantly, usually ranging from EUR800 to EUR2,000 for a total bundle that consists of theory and useful lessons.
  3. Total the Theory Test

    • The Code de la Route (Road Code) test is a considerable element of the licensing process. It includes multiple-choice questions covering traffic laws, signs, and safe driving practices.
    • The typical cost for the theory test has to do with EUR30.
  4. Pass the Practical Driving Test

    • The useful test evaluates your driving abilities on the road. Lessons in preparation may add up, costing around EUR45-EUR100 per lesson.
    • The charge for the practical test is usually between EUR120 to EUR200.
  5. Obtain Insurance and Register Your License

    • Upon passing both tests, one must register their new license and often take out vehicle insurance coverage before hitting the road.

Cost Breakdown of Obtaining a French Driving License

To offer a clearer picture, here's an in-depth table showcasing prospective costs associated with obtaining a French driving license:

ExpenseApproximated Cost (in Euro)
Driving School EnrollmentEUR800 - EUR2,000
Theory Test FeeEUR30
Dry Run FeeEUR120 - EUR200
Practical Driving LessonsEUR45 - EUR100 per lesson
License Registration FeeEUR30 - EUR50
Overall Estimated CostEUR1,050 - EUR2,800

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I drive in France with a foreign license?

If you have a foreign driving license, you can drive in France briefly. However, after one year of residency, you might need to exchange it for a French license depending upon your native land.

2. The length of time does it require to obtain a French driving license?

The procedure can take anywhere from a couple of months to over a year, depending on your personal scenarios, how rapidly you can complete required lessons, the schedule of test dates, and if you need to await your driving school.

3. Is the French driving test challenging?

The tests are developed to ensure chauffeurs are knowledgeable about traffic laws and safe driving practices. It may be challenging for those unknown with French road signs and guidelines. Adequate preparation is key to passing both tests.

4. What if I stop working the driving tests?

You may retake the driving tests, however it is subject to waiting durations of varying lengths depending upon your area. Additionally, the expenses for retaking tests and lessons will be your duty.
